THE PAROCHIAL CHURCH COUNCIL OF THE ECCLESIASTICAL PARISH OF WALTON-ON-THAMES
Financial health, per its FY2025 accounts
The accounts state that the unrestricted general fund ended the year with a deficit of £22,000, a reversal from the previous year's surplus, driven by high expenditure on church hall repairs and curate house refurbishments. Total reserves across all funds decreased to £495,491 from £548,489, though the unrestricted fund balance remains above the stated policy target of three months' unrestricted payments. The charity reports adequate resources for going concern purposes but notes that underlying giving has decreased, creating continued dependence on hall rental income.
What the accounts disclose
“Historically it is has been the PCC’s policy to maintain a cash balance in the Reserve Fund equating to approximately three months’ unrestricted payments.” — page 8
“One member of the Parochial Church Council received remuneration during the year. Charity Commission approval was obtained, as required, in order to enable the Parochial Church Council to employ a member of the Council.” — page 24

Income and spending
| Financial year end | Income | Spending |
|---|---|---|
| 31/12/2025 | £385k | £435k |
| 31/12/2024 | £319k | £316k |
| 31/12/2023 | £466k | £307k |
| 31/12/2022 | £415k | £280k |
| 31/12/2021 | £277k | £261k |
